Hey folks,

Quick handover before I rotate off the Binwise pick-list optimizer. Plugin hooks are stable now — the scoring callback fires after aisle clustering, not before, so don't cache zone weights. Solver timeouts were the main support headache last quarter, so check those first if routes look weird. The optimizer currently runs with the configuration values shown below.

service settings:
quenath:
  log_level: info
  metrics_host: metrics.quenath.tolvaqlabs.internal
  pin: 1407
  pool_size: 8

# Shelfwright catalogue import — on-call notes.
# Hey, if you're reading this at 3am: the nightly import pulls MARC records from
# the Pellbrook consortium feed and stuffs them into the Larkmoor catalogue.
# BATCH_SIZE of 500 is deliberate — bigger batches trip the dedupe timeout.
# If the import stalls, bounce the worker before touching anything else; it
# almost always recovers. Full runbook lives on the team wiki under "imports."
# The feed access credential belongs on the line right below this block.

env line for fafof-fahag: LEDGER_TOKEN5=f8790

Ticket: FIELD-2281 — Expired credentials blocking offline sync

For the weekly sync: the Heronpath field-survey app's offline mode stopped reconciling on Monday because the cached sync token expired while crews were out of coverage. Surveys queued locally are intact, but uploads fail silently until re-auth. We've extended token lifetime to 30 days and reissued credentials. The replacement key for the internal sync service follows.

service key, fafog-fahaf: vxb3-x55

After the Halloway upgrade, the Crevane query planner began choosing sequential scans on the orders table, regressing p95 latency by roughly 4x. Mitigation is to pin the old plan via the planner-hints sidecar until the stats job is fixed. The sidecar talks to the metrics backend to log plan choices, and it reads its auth from the service env file. Put the metrics backend credential in that file.

secret setting of hawep-yahig: LEDGER_TOKEN29=41b5d6315371c92885eaeb077fb63